MKS Dąbrowa Górnicza: Tactical Approach and Current Form

Entering this game, MKS Dąbrowa Górnicza's recent form has been a mixed bag. With two wins and three losses in their last five games, they have struggled to find consistency. Nevertheless, their offensive system is a structured one, with a strong focus on ball movement and perimeter shooting. Averaging 37.2% from beyond the arc this season, Dąbrowa has relied on the three-point shot to generate most of their offense. Expect to see a high number of outside shots, especially from their primary perimeter players like shooting guard Aaron Cel and small forward Darnell Harris, who are capable of stretching the defense. These two players are the engines behind the offense, each averaging double-digit points and playing a significant role in spacing the floor.

In terms of team strategy, Dąbrowa often runs a motion offense that emphasizes quick ball rotations and open looks from the perimeter. However, their lack of size inside has been a weakness, especially when matched up against teams with stronger interior play. Defensively, MKS tends to play a fluid man-to-man defense, but they can struggle against fast-breaking teams and high-powered offenses, allowing an average of 81.4 points per game. They will need to limit turnovers and control the pace to avoid falling into a high-scoring affair that could benefit Anwil Włocławek.

One of their key players, point guard Jarosław Zyskowski, has been crucial for MKS's transition play, pushing the ball up the court and looking for easy baskets in fast breaks. However, Zyskowski’s injury earlier in the season still seems to have an impact on his explosiveness, and his ability to run the offense efficiently will be a major factor in this match. Dąbrowa’s fate may hinge on how well they execute their half-court offense and whether they can disrupt Anwil’s transition game.

Anwil Włocławek: Tactical Approach and Current Form

On the other side, Anwil Włocławek comes into this match with a more solid and consistent run of form, having won four of their last five games. Their approach to the game revolves around physicality and transition basketball, with an emphasis on pushing the pace and capitalizing on fast-break opportunities. Anwil has one of the best transition offenses in the league, averaging 15.4 fast-break points per game, largely thanks to their versatile forwards like Krzysztof Sulima and the explosive guard Stefan Krajewski.

Offensively, Anwil’s system revolves around ball control and dominating the paint. They lead the league in rebounds per game (40.3) and have a significant advantage in second-chance opportunities. Their ability to crash the boards and create second-chance points, thanks to the relentless efforts of center Pawel Leończyk, gives them an edge in a game that could become a battle of attrition. Expect Anwil to dictate the tempo with a heavy focus on getting the ball inside to Leończyk, who can both finish with authority and facilitate offense in the post.

Defensively, Anwil has been much stronger than Dąbrowa, allowing just 75.3 points per game, and they are particularly effective at limiting opponents' three-point attempts. They play a well-disciplined zone defense that clogs the paint, forcing teams to settle for contested outside shots. If Anwil can limit MKS’s perimeter shooting, they will force Dąbrowa to take difficult shots, especially given their vulnerability in the low post. However, their aggressive defense sometimes leads to foul trouble, so maintaining discipline without compromising defensive intensity will be crucial.

The key to Anwil’s success will lie in the hands of their backcourt. Krajewski’s speed and playmaking will be crucial for breaking down Dąbrowa’s defense, while Sulima’s ability to stretch the floor will pull defenders out of the paint, allowing Leończyk more room to operate. The synergy between these players and the overall defensive intensity of the team will be critical in determining the outcome of this game.

Head-to-Head: History and Psychology

In their previous encounters this season, Anwil Włocławek has held a slight edge, winning three out of their last four meetings with MKS Dąbrowa Górnicza. The last time these two teams faced off, Anwil emerged victorious in a tense, high-scoring affair, winning 92-87. Historically, Anwil has been able to exploit Dąbrowa's lack of interior presence, with Leończyk and his teammates dominating the paint in both scoring and rebounding. However, when Dąbrowa has been able to control the tempo and keep the game from becoming a track meet, they’ve managed to keep the score close and even pull off some surprises.

The mental aspect of this clash is also important. MKS Dąbrowa Górnicza will be under pressure to protect their home court, while Anwil comes in with the confidence of a team in good form, knowing they can exploit Dąbrowa’s weaknesses. The psychological edge could swing either way, but it will depend on which team can impose their rhythm early in the game.
